Donald Trump’s so-called One Big Beautiful Bill Act, as passed by House Republicans, would trigger automatic Medicare cuts.
Nonpartisan research groups studying the proposal have estimated that it would add more than $2.5 trillion to the federal debt—currently at an all-time high of $36.8 trillion—over the next decade. Despite those projections,
